Severn Beach train station may be compact, but it offers essential facilities to ensure a smooth travel experience. Although there is no ticket office or ticket machines available, modern conveniences are still prioritized. For instance, travelers can take advantage of the station's step-free access to all platforms, catering to passengers with varied mobility needs. Additionally, an induction loop is available to support hearing-impaired individuals. While the station does not have waiting rooms, ample seating areas provide a place for passengers to relax while awaiting their trains.
Once you arrive at Severn Beach, a variety of onward travel options await. While the station itself does not feature a taxi rank, the convenient location on Station Road allows easy access to local bus services. For rail replacement services, the bus stop at the edge of the platform on Station Road is readily available. Though taxi services are not directly available from the station, nearby facilities provide ample options for your onward journey. For bicyclists, bike storage is available with Sheffield hoops near the platform entrance to cater to cycling enthusiasts.

Formby Station is equipped with various facilities aimed at making your journey seamless. For purchasing tickets, you can take advantage of their ticket office, which opens early at 5:38 AM during the weekdays and stays open until 12:21 AM, ensuring ample time for travellers to organize their trips. If you prefer more independent solutions, ticket machines are also available and cater to smartcard users with both card issuance and validation options. However, do note the absence of accessible ticket machines, which might require some travellers to seek assistance from the staff. Fortunately though, an induction loop is in place to aid those with hearing difficulties.
Accessibility at Formby Station is commendable, with step-free access across the station. This ease of movement is further complemented by available ramps for train boarding. Facilities like toilets, including baby-changing amenities, are provided, though accessible toilets are currently not available. The station is also stocked with a seating area, so you can wait in comfort for your train. Additionally, while no Wi-Fi is present, you can find a food vending machine, although shoppers and cash-seekers might need to plan their needs before arrival since there are no ATMs or shops.
Transportation to and from Formby Station is straightforward. For those looking to connect to other forms of transit, options are diverse if you plan ahead. The nearest airport is Liverpool John Lennon Airport, and you can conveniently purchase a combined rail/bus ticket from any Merseyrail station. Bus routes like the 86A or 80A link Liverpool South Parkway with the airport, taking merely 10 minutes.
Although there's no dedicated taxi rank at Formby Station, alternative arrangements can be made via ride-shares or local taxi services. Further transportation options include rail replacement services departing from Formby Bridge, in case of any unforeseen travel disruptions. For up-to-the-minute travel plans by bus, information is readily available online or through the Traveline contact number.
